I seem to have a little issue with my USB Evolution MK-449C keyboard.

Recently I bought myself an E-MU Planet Phatt sound module.

I now have my MK-449C connected to the pc through USB, the keyboard’s MIDI out is connected to the MIDI in from the Planet Phatt module, but the module does not seem to receive any MIDI signal from my keyboard.
The module is connected to my pc by stereo jack cables. When I play demo songs on the PP module I can hear them through my pc speakers. I can also record these demo songs in Sonar. I think it is a matter of assigning the MIDI channels, but I just can’t seem to figure out how to properly do that. Can anyone PLEASE help me out?


Thanks in advance.
 
When you play your keyboard, do you have your sequencer set to echo its midi in to its midi out? That needs to be done in software somehow.
 
You really need to check your manuals and figure out how to assign the midi channels. You probably just need to turn something on in one of the menus.

Make sure that the controller is set to send midi on CH1 and that the EMU is setup to receive midi on CH1. That will get you started.
